Transaction 33ae1154afae7a6b12ba42707f43581a1ee38fe51d3996df016bf8854da091c2
1 Input
2 Outputs
- 33ae1154afae7a6b12ba42707f43581a1ee38fe51d3996df016bf8854da091c2:0
- 33ae1154afae7a6b12ba42707f43581a1ee38fe51d3996df016bf8854da091c2:1
value 30000000
address 17YSU9WTivAZxjqLBfZ1kvGR9umPkiowzQ
value 1963499873
address 1DPAfFCSvwTUMpU8YZcq6mb1RWJaqg1m3i